What Does Garlic Paste Taste Like. Garlic paste has a robust, pungent, and savory flavor. The taste of garlic is characterized by its strong and distinctive notes, which can be both sharp and slightly sweet. Put the garlic in the bowl of a food processor with the salt, and process until the garlic is as fine as possible. Use a rubber spatula to scrape down the sides as needed. Add a teaspoon of lemon juice and process to create a bit of a paste. With the food processor running, drizzle about 3 tablespoons into the paste.

Follow the steps below to preserve homemade garlic paste. Store in the refrigerator in an air-tight glass container for about 7-10 days. To preserve for 3-4 months, transfer the garlic paste to an ice cube tray (preferably with a lid to avoid freezer burn), leaving some space for expansion.

Ginger-garlic paste: a step-by-step guide. Peel the ginger and chop it into 1-2 inch pieces (makes it easier to blend). Peel the skin of the garlic or buy store-bought peeled garlic (which is what I do). Toss the ingredients into the blender jar or food processor along with oil and salt and grind them to a fine paste.

For long-term storage, you can: Freeze: Follow the instructions for freezing peeled garlic mentioned above. Dehydrate: Slice or mince the garlic, spread it evenly on a dehydrator tray, and dry at 115°F (46°C) for 6-8 hours, or until completely dry. Store the dried garlic in an airtight container in a cool, dark place.

The shelf life of garlic depends on how and where you store it. Properly stored fresh and whole garlic can last up to five months in the pantry and 12 months in the freezer. Transfer the garlic paste to an air tight glass container. Top with a thin layer of oil. It can be refrigerated for up to 2 weeks. To store for longer, freeze in ice-cube trays or resealable plastic bags for 3-4 months.

Add salt and oil to ginger garlic paste to make it last longer. You can alter the amount of salt and oil that you add depending on your taste preferences, but a good measurement is 1 tsp (4.9 ml) of salt and 1 US tbsp (15 ml) of vegetable or olive oil for every 1 cup (240 ml) of ginger garlic paste.

How long does garlic last? Unpeeled, a head of garlic can keep up to six months when stored properly, while a single, unpeeled clove will last about three weeks. When you're trying to tell if food is spoiled, keep an eye out for certain things: look, smell and feel. Look for brown spots on your garlic cloves—garlic is mostly an off-white.
